Emergency Services were called out to a property fire in the south of the Island yesterday.
Crews from Castletown and Port Erin responded to the incident in Queen Street in the early evening.
Breathing apparatus and a hose reel weer used to tackle the blaze.
Roads in the area had to be closed off whilst firefighters extinguished the flames.
